A decrease court may well not rule against a binding precedent, even though it feels that it really is unjust; it might only express the hope that a higher court or maybe the legislature will reform the rule in question. In the event the court thinks that developments or trends in legal reasoning render the precedent unhelpful, and needs to evade it and help the regulation evolve, it could possibly hold that the precedent is inconsistent with subsequent authority, or that it should be distinguished by some material difference between the facts on the cases; some jurisdictions allow for a judge to recommend that an appeal be performed.

Law professors traditionally have played a much more compact role in developing case legislation in common law than professors in civil legislation. Because court decisions in civil law traditions are historically brief[four] rather than formally amenable to establishing precedent, much in the exposition of your regulation in civil law traditions is finished by lecturers rather than by judges; this is called doctrine and will be published in treatises or in journals like Recueil Dalloz in France. Historically, common regulation courts relied small on legal scholarship; So, for the turn from the twentieth century, it was incredibly uncommon to find out a tutorial writer quoted in a very legal decision (other than perhaps with the educational writings of notable judges like case law Coke and Blackstone).

Case law, also known as precedent or common law, is the body of prior judicial decisions that guide judges deciding issues before them. Depending on the relationship between the deciding court as well as precedent, case law might be binding or merely persuasive. For example, a decision by the U.S. Court of Appeals with the Fifth Circuit is binding on all federal district courts within the Fifth Circuit, but a court sitting down in California (whether a federal or state court) is just not strictly bound to Stick to the Fifth Circuit’s prior decision. Similarly, a decision by a single district court in New York will not be binding on another district court, but the initial court’s reasoning may well help guide the second court in reaching its decision. Decisions via the U.S. Supreme Court are binding on all federal and state courts. Read more
